A car rental company is interested in the amount of time its vehicles are out of operation for repair work State all assumptions and find a 98% confidence interval for the mean number of days in a year that all vehicles in the company's feet are out of operation if a random sample of 10 cars showed the following number of days that each had been inoperative 21 15 19 17 11 10 29 18 23 6
